GOAL PLANNING
WORKSHEET EXAMPLE
# WHAT WHO WHEN
1
Launch a multi-channel communication
campaign that includes email newsletters,
fliers, social media, and the community
app.
John H.
Send reminders 2 weeks, 1
week, and 1 day before each
board meeting.
2
Incentivize meeting attendance. Gather
and apply the necessary resources to offer
small perks for attending, especially for
first-time attendees or those who bring a
neighbor.
Karla Z.
Formalize incentives 2 weeks
before the next board meeting.
3
Organize a 30-minute, pre-meeting
social event, like a coffee meetup or pizza
with the board, to encourage attendance in
a more relaxed environment.
William B.
Solidify plans and secure the
necessary resources and funding
in 1 month.
4
Review and update meeting content,
including the agenda and reports, to
simplify and make the meeting more
engaging.
Brittany J.
Approve updated content at least
2 weeks before the next board
meeting.
5
Track and evaluate progress to ensure
efforts are affecting measurable change.
Kevin T. Monthly after each board meeting.
GOAL:
Increase homeowner attendance at board meetings by 25% in 6 months through
improved communication and events.
